What is a Private Psychiatrist?

A private psychiatrist is a competent medical doctor who concentrates on mental health concerns. Unlike their NHS counterparts, private psychiatrists use consultations and treatments through private psychiatrist uk (notes.bmcs.one) practice. They are trained to detect and treat various mental health conditions, varying from anxiety and depression to more complex conditions like schizophrenia and bipolar affective disorder.

The Costs Involved

When thinking about private psychiatric services, comprehending the possible expenses is critical. Fees for consultations can vary commonly based on factors such as place, psychiatrist experience, and treatment complexity.

ServiceTypical Cost (₤)
Initial Assessment₤ 200 - ₤ 500
Follow-up Consultation₤ 100 - ₤ 250
Medication Management₤ 50 - ₤ 200 per prescription
Therapy Sessions₤ 80 - ₤ 150 per hour

While these expenses can build up, many individuals might find the financial investment beneficial for faster and more customized care. Additionally, some health insurance coverage strategies might cover the expenditures connected to private psychiatric care.

How to Find a Private Psychiatrist

Discovering the right private psychiatrist can feel frustrating, but here are some steps to assist at the same time:

  1. Research Online: Several online directories list private psychiatrists based on location, specializeds, or client reviews.

  2. Request for Recommendations: Friends, household, or primary care doctors might supply beneficial recommendations based on their experiences.

  3. Examine Credentials: Ensure that the psychiatrist is regist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) and has relevant certifications and experience.

  4. Think about Specialization: Depending on your mental health concerns, you may want to find a psychiatrist who concentrates on specific areas such as dependency, injury, or kid and teen psychiatry.

  5. Schedule an Initial Consultation: Many psychiatrists use an initial assessment; take this opportunity to gauge their technique, design, and whether you feel comfy with them.
